Buttermilk Naan Bread
- 1 cup flour, all-purpose
- 1 package yeast, active dry dry
- 2 teaspoons salt
- 1 cup water hot
- 1 cup buttermilk or yogurt
- 1 each eggs (room temp)
- 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
- 1 tablespoon honey or sugar
- 2 1/2 cups flour, all-purpose
- 1 x ghee (clarified butter) (clarified butter)
- Combine 1 cup flour, yeast, and salt in a mixing bowl.
- Stir in water, buttermilk, egg, oil and honey.
- Beat until smooth with an electric mixer.
- Stir in enough remaining flour to form a soft, sticky dough.
- Turn onto a floured surface, continue to work in flour until dough is stiff enough to knead.
- Knead until smooth and elastic, but still soft (3 to 5 minutes).
- Place in an oiled bowl; turning once to coat top of dough.
- Cover; let rise until double in bulk (about 45 minutes).
- Punch dough down.
- Shape into 16 equal balls.
- Let rest 5 minutes.
- Roll out each ball to a 1/4 inch thick round.
- If desired, brush with melted butter and sprinkle with garnishes.
- Set on baking sheets.
- Bake at 450F (230C).
- for 5 to 8 minutes.
- NOTE: There is no second rising in this recipe so that you get flat loaves.
